National Security

The核信息项目provides the public with the best unclassified information about the status and trends of the world’s nuclear weapons arsenals, and advocates for responsible reductions in the numbers and operations of nuclear weapons to reduce nuclear dangers. The Project has a long and proven record as one of the most widely referenced and reliable sources for providing such information to the news media, lawmakers, scholars, expert institutes, and grassroots organizations. The Project seeks to empower the public debate with new and reliable information to better challenge government nuclear secrecy, promote responsible reductions in the role of and reliance on nuclear weapons, save billions of dollars by reducing excess and redundant forces, and make greater strides towards responsible deep cuts—and eventually the elimination—of nuclear weapons.

Additionally, the Nuclear Information Project conducted deep dives into particular nuclear weapons topics in order to influence the public and political debate in advance of the Biden administration’s upcoming Nuclear Posture Review. One Nuclear Information Project report,“Siloed Thinking: A Closer Look at the Ground-Based Strategic Deterrent,”reviewed the fundamental role of ICBMs in U.S. nuclear strategy and examined the Pentagon’s justifications for pursuing an ICBM replacement program. The report was widely covered by national, local, and international media––including守护者,Politico,Daily Beast,奥马哈世界先驱,Democracy Now!,Der Spiegel––and its findings were included in Senator Ed Markey (D-MA) and Congressman Ro Khanna’s (D-CA)ICBM Act

Defense Posture Project

National Security

Over the past year, theDefense Posture Projecthas worked hard to inform the new administration’s nuclear weapons policies. In January, Project Director Dr.Adam Mountpublished a report with then-Carnegie Endowment for International Peace fellow Pranay Vaddi on an integrated approach to deterrence. The report, “一个集成的方法来威慑姿态,” argued that the new administration should not separate its review of nuclear weapons policy from its review on defense policy in general, but develop an integrated concept of deterrence.

The team conducted interviews over several months with former and future senior administration officials, and then briefed the report to groups at the National Security Council and Department of Defense offices for Nuclear and Missile Defense and Strategy and Force Development. Senior officials reported that the work “has been very influential.” The concept of “integrated deterrence” has since become a major priority for the Pentagon, and senior defense officials have pledged that the Nuclear Posture Review will be “nested” in the National Defense Strategy. Dr. Mount also spoke on the subject at the Institut Français des Relations Internationales and the Center for Strategic and International Studies.

The Project also undertook a new initiative to help the new administration define and understand the implications of President Biden’s commitment to declare that the sole purpose of our nuclear arsenal is deterrence of a nuclear attack. Project on Government Secrecy

National Security

Through research and advocacy, theProject on Government Secrecydirected bySteven Aftergood致力于促进公共访问to valuable government information and to reduce the scope of national security secrecy.

The Project provides the public with unique access to essential government records. For example, a 2020 Joint Chiefs of Staff manual on nuclear warfighting (JP 3-72,Nuclear Operations) that the Project obtained this year through the Freedom of Information Act is available on the FAS website, even though it cannot be found in the Pentagon’s doctrinal library. The Project likewise offers the most complete collection of presidential national securitydirectives, reports of theJASONdefense science advisory panel, and other high value documents. As a result, online traffic to the FAS website has grown tremendously, regularly reaching millions of viewers.

This is a year of transition for secrecy policy as the new administration formulates its own approach to openness in government, in many cases rejecting or revising past practices. The President has名义上认可“the highest standards of transparency,” but achieving this remains a work in progress. The Project works with government agency officials and congressional staff to define and advance specific openness goals, such as a fixed limit to the duration of national security classification and an expanded program of open source intelligence publication.

Defense Budget

National Security

With a grant from Schmidt Futures, the Day One Project has begun work in coordination with the Department of Defense, the Congressional defense committees, and various non-government centers of influence to shape the establishment of a congressional commission to examine the relevance of the DoD’s Planning, Programming, Budgeting, and Execution (PPBE) system and its associated resource allocation processes against the backdrop of the speed at which the 21st-century international security environment is evolving. The goal of this commission will be to broker a lasting political compromise with actionable, bipartisan recommendations that will result in the most comprehensive reform of the PPBE system since the President’s Blue Ribbon Commission on Defense Management, the so-called Packard Commission, and the resulting Goldwaters-Nichols Act of 1986. The benefit to the nation will be a modern military capable of fielding new combat capabilities at pace with the speed of commercial innovation and within the decision cycles of our most determined adversaries.

Biological Weapons Convention Scientific Advisory Process

National Security

The objective of this project is to plan an SAP for the BWC that can provide science-based and politically reliable analyses of developments in science and emerging biotechnologies. The SAP would enable all States Parties to make informed decisions by ensuring that they have impartial technical assessments of developments in science and technology, potential risks for use contrary to the Convention, and potential benefits. FAS organized a series of two-day workshops to spur progress on a scientific advisory process through research and discussions with 40 experts from 25 countries, including all five UN Regional Groups. FAS used the results and outputs from the workshops, along with their research, to craft the Findings from the Workshops, which were submitted by the United States as an official document of the BWC Meeting of Experts on Science and Technology held in Geneva from September 1-2, 2021. The U.S. representative introduced the document, andJenifer Mackby, FAS Senior Fellow, presented the Findings to the Meeting. The Workshops were supported by the Department of State and Open Philanthropy, with assistance in coordination by the InterAcademy Partnership.

Technology Policy Accelerator

技术和创新

In March, the Day One Project launched its Technology Policy Accelerator to identify, develop, and publish a set of technology policy ideas that could be implemented by Congress or the Biden-Harris Administration. The accelerator was a nine-week process designed to guide the cohort of30entrepreneurs, academics, researchers, and technologists to transform an initial idea into a tailored, actionable set of policy recommendations.

Through the Accelerator, the cohort developed their ideas with guidance from policy advisors, met with veteran policymakers to learn more about the nuances of policy implementation, honed their ability to craft actionable policy on the federal level, and built a community with their fellow cohort members. The Accelerator culminated with a showcase featuring several policy presentations from the cohort, complimented by presentations on federal tech policy from Quentin Palfrey, formerly Acting General Counsel at the Department of Commerce, and Cori Zarek, former U.S. Deputy Chief Technology Officer.

人才中心

2021年1月,一天一个项目开始没完g critically about issues facing federal agencies and has since been actively finding ways to help advance top policy priorities through talent. The Day One Project launched its Day One Talent Hub to provide a pathway for federal leaders to access diverse, leading scientific and technological experts interested in a “tour of service” in the federal government. The Talent Hub focuses its efforts on leveraging flexible hiring pathways (such as fellowships and the Intergovernmental Personnel Act (IPA) Mobility Program) to identify and place qualified scientific and technical talent (i.e., fellows) into key roles working inside federal agencies.

Based on insights gleaned from federal leaders, the Day One Talent Hub identified significant demand and opportunity for talent placements across the federal government to advance an expansive scope of priorities. Upon publication of this report, the Day One Talent Hub has so far identified, onboarded, and placed 10 fellows into high-impact roles this year. Fellows have been deployed at or are being recruited to enter the following agencies:

In addition to placing fellows, the Talent Hub undertook significant efforts to provide technical assistance to federal agencies in better implementing flexible hiring pathways to bring on critical S&T capacity. The Talent Hub team conducted conversations with25+federal agencies and offices to address their talent needs. It also released “Flexible Hiring Resources for Federal Managers,” a guidebook that provides practical information to better leverage available mechanisms to hire scientific and technical talent, including resources and templates to utilize the Intergovernmental Personnel Act Mobility Program and Schedule A fellowship-hiring authority.
